“…Note that in the field of systems and control, such methods are referred to as modular or subsystem MOR [5,6]. However, in the field of structural dynamics, the most popular component-level approach is component mode synthesis, which has been studied since the early sixties [7] and remains an active area of research to this date [8,9]. CMS is also a projection-based approach that typically involves identifying and extracting the most important vibration modes from the component Finite Element (FE) models and then combining them in a way that accurately represents the dynamic behavior of the original assembly.…”
